two capacitor having capacitance of 10uf and 5uf are connected in series and this combination is connected in parallel with a 20v supplies this parallel combination calculate the charge on each capacitor .the voltage across the 10uc capacitor.

C1 = 10uF, C2 = 5uF.
C = C1*C2/(C1+C2) = (10*5)/(10+5) = 3.33 uF.
a. Q1 = Q2 = C*V = 3.33 * 20 = 66.6 Micro Coulombs.
b. V1 + V2 = 20
V2 = 10uF/5uF * V1 = 2V1,
V1 + 2V1 = 20, V1 = 6.66 Volts.
